About Cleopatra Enterprise

Cleopatra Enterprise is an advanced, all-in-one cost management software developed by Cost Engineering to support accurate cost estimating, project control, and benchmarking throughout the entire project lifecycle.

Pros & Cons

  • Seamlessly links Cost Estimating, Controls, and Scheduling in one loop.
  • Includes the CESK dataset, providing ready-to-use, accurate industry cost norms.
  • Built specifically for complex Shutdowns and Turnarounds (not just general PM).
  • Reduces manual errors by eliminating fragmented spreadsheets.
  • Developed by cost engineers, not just software coders.
  • High learning curve; requires professional cost engineering knowledge.
  • Overkill (and expensive) for small, simple projects.
  • Implementation and integration with ERPs (like SAP) can be slow.
